Analysts can leverage drag-and-drop tools alongside generative AI to prepare and blend data up to 100 times faster compared to traditional methods. A self-service data analytics platform empowers every analyst by eliminating costly bottlenecks in the analytics process. Alteryx Designer stands out as a self-service data analytics solution that equips analysts to effectively prepare, blend, and analyze data through user-friendly, drag-and-drop interfaces. The platform boasts compatibility with over 300 automation tools and integrates seamlessly with more than 80 data sources. By prioritizing low-code and no-code features, Alteryx Designer allows users to construct analytic workflows effortlessly, expedite analytical tasks using generative AI, and derive insights without requiring extensive programming knowledge. Additionally, it facilitates the export of results to more than 70 different tools, showcasing its exceptional versatility. Overall, this design enhances operational efficiency, enabling organizations to accelerate their data preparation and analytical processes significantly.

Enable your data team to concentrate on what truly matters. Instantly provide answers to on-the-spot inquiries from business stakeholders. Stakeholders receive immediate responses to their questions. Non-technical users can directly pose questions in Slack or Teams, and the Data Analyst Language Model (DaLM) delivers the answers swiftly. This approach minimizes the time wasted on ad-hoc inquiries, allowing for a sharper focus on analyses that contribute to revenue enhancement. By empowering analysts to prioritize critical tasks, you enhance overall productivity. Simply access a file containing previous queries to kick things off. DaLM assimilates the business logic inherent in these queries and continually refines its performance as analysts engage more with the Integrated Development Environment (IDE). Initiate the process in just five minutes, regardless of your database's size or complexity. We ensure that no data is tracked, and your database's actual content remains within your environment. While the schema and query code are shared with the model, no real data is transmitted, and any personally identifiable information (PII) within the query code is adequately masked. This guarantees not only efficiency but also the utmost security and privacy for your data.
